[quote="Ringthane";p="551619"]I don't understand something - how is it that the comic page won't work, but the forums still do? Aren't they all hosted on the same server (or group of servers)? I've never understood that.[/quote]
Greg owns the comic, I own the forums. There is an affiliation, but there's nothing binding. Should Greg choose to, he could disassociate himself from here, at which point we'd change the logos and remove the comic references, and then we'd continue on.

Real Life Comics is hosted on its own server in one part of the country, and Real Life Forums is hosted on an Illuminus server in Southern California. Different boxes, different ISPs, different owners.
